Technical Security Measures
- SSL Certificates: The Certificate Transparency log (crt.sh) shows “104 cert(s) found” for itbits.ie. This indicates that the website uses SSL/TLS encryption. S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) is crucial for securing online communications. When you see “https://” in the URL and a padlock icon in your browser, it means data transmitted between your browser and the website (like login credentials, personal information, or payment details) is encrypted. This prevents unauthorized third parties from intercepting and reading your data. The high number of certificates suggests regular updates and proper maintenance of security.
- No Blacklisting: The report explicitly states “Not Blacklisted.” This is a significant safety indicator. Blacklists are databases that identify websites known for malicious activities such as hosting malware, phishing, spamming, or engaging in fraudulent behavior. A clean record means the site has not been flagged as a security threat by major online security organizations.
- Legitimate DNS Records: The presence of A, AAAA, NS, and MX records confirms that the domain is properly configured on the internet, pointing to legitimate servers and email services. This indicates a professionally managed web presence, which is less common for unsafe or fly-by-night operations.
Operational Safety & Trust Signals
- Domain Age: The domain was created in 2008, signifying over 15 years of online existence. Websites that are designed to be unsafe (e.g., phishing sites, malware distributors) are typically short-lived to avoid detection. This longevity suggests stability and a commitment to maintaining an online presence.
- Standard E-commerce Practices: The site features a shopping cart, checkout, and account management, which imply the use of standard e-commerce platforms and payment gateways. Reputable payment gateways (e.g., those handling credit card transactions) employ their own layers of security to protect customer financial data. While the specific payment gateway isn’t mentioned, the presence of a “Checkout” page strongly implies one is in use.
- Clear Product Offerings: The website sells physical IT hardware products, which are legitimate goods. There’s no indication of suspicious products, get-rich-quick schemes, or other content typically associated with unsafe or fraudulent websites.
